    • Effect Sizes Why, When, and How to Use Them 

      Rosnow, RL.; Rosenthal, Robert (Hogrefe & Huber Publishers, 2009)
      The effect size (ES) is the magnitude of a study outcome or research finding, such as the strength of the relationship obtained between an independent variable and a dependent variable. Two types of ES indicators are sampled ...
